Drift compensation in the Verdanta controller now recalibrates hourly, not per-read. Plugin authors: stop smoothing sensor output yourselves — double-filtering caused the humidity oscillation Renke reported. If your plugin overrides the baseline, clamp within the allowed band or the scheduler rejects it. The defaults your plugins inherit are as follows.

tuning table, faweg-bajep:
WEIGHTS = {
    "belius": 690,
    "eliox": 458,
    "norax": 616,
    "praion": 132,
    "zorvan": 911,
}

**Ticket: Schema registry rejects valid event versions**

Plugin authors integrating with the Corvannt event bus report that the Hollowgate schema registry returns compatibility errors for minor-version bumps that only add optional fields. This contradicts the documented backward-compatibility policy. Workaround: register under a new subject name, though this fragments consumer groups. Fix is targeted for the next registry release; please retest your plugins against it once deployed. The candidate build's token appears below.

pipeline stamp: htk31_f769b577b3028a4e9958e5bb8d1259a

## Who to Ask: Hermetic Build Migration

We're partway through moving the Quillbase monorepo onto the Fernhollow hermetic build system. Most targets build cleanly now, but anything touching codegen or vendored C deps is still flaky. Before you burn an afternoon debugging sandbox errors, check the migration tracker page — odds are someone's already hit your issue. For sandbox config questions, the infra crew owns that layer. For everything else about the migration itself, reach out to the build tooling group.

escalation mailbox, bafog-fafog: ulador@paliqlabs.internal

Visitor policy — Hollyvale Robotics, intern cohort arrival. Interns arrive Monday 09:00 at the Westgate lobby. They count as visitors until badged, so sign each one in and issue a lanyard. Do not let them roam unescorted. Escort groups to the level 3 training suite. The suite door stays locked; admit them using this pass code:

staff pass of kagup-fajog = bdg-QCHVQW-99665837